WebJan 25, 2024 · The Impact on Food Insecurity in Africa. Across Africa, an estimated 100 million people faced catastrophic levels of food insecurity in 2024; the latest data show that 40.2 million people in Central and Southern Africa, 32.9 million in East Africa, and 24.8 million in West and Sahel Africa faced food crisis and starvation. This is due to ... WebApr 5, 2024 · West Africa is hit by its worst food crisis in a decade, with 27 million people going hungry. This number could rise to 38 million this June - a new historic level and already an increase by more than a third over last year- unless urgent action is taken. WebTomatoes, which were also introduced to Africa from the New World, are another widely accepted addition to most dishes. However Nigerian cuisine, for example, tends to omit them, in favour of a deep paprika-like capsicum known locally as tatashe.. WebSep 8, 2024 · The $716 million Food System Resilience Program (FSRP) is one such approach. It aims to benefit more than four million people in West Africa by increasing agricultural productivity through climate-smart agriculture, promoting intraregional value chains, and building regional capacity to manage agricultural risks. Fufu is a West African dish that typically includes fresh or fermented cassava and various veggies, spices, meat, or fish. It can be found in Sierra Leone, Guinea, Liberia, Cote D'Ivoire (Ivory Coast), Benin ...

Cabbage stew is a dish prepared using a mixture of cabbage, chicken, Maggi cubes, meat tenderizer, beef, tomato paste, black pepper, chicken bouillon, onions and vegetable oil.
